The FeeForge rules engine, which computes shipping fees for Marlowe Mercantile checkouts, is intermittently failing to reach its rules database since the 14:20 deploy. Symptoms: pool acquisition timeouts every few minutes, fee evaluation falling back to cached rules. Restarting the service clears it for roughly an hour. Suspect a leaked connection in the new tier-lookup path. On-call: please enable pool tracing and capture a leak report. Use the staging database via the connection string below.

replica DSN, kagaf-kajef: postgresql://eliius_svc:UA@db-a408.paliqnet.internal:5432/istys

Before shipping Gridwright 4.2, double-check the clue-bank sync job actually finished — last time it half-copied and we shipped a puzzle with two identical across clues. Run the dry-run packer, eyeball the symmetry report, and tag the candidate. Once you're happy, record the build token from the packer output right under this line.

build token for kagaf-hahof: htk14_9d3d4d26d7d8de

### Step 4 — Wire up Fixturesmith

Fixturesmith is our test-data factory library; it seeds realistic-looking orders and accounts into the staging database so your integration tests aren't running against empty tables. Clone the seeds repo, run the bootstrap script, and you're most of the way there. One gotcha: the seeder talks to the Harbourline staging API, and it won't start without credentials in your env file. Add the API credential on the line right after this note.

sealed setting: ARCHIVE_KEY3=8d0

Subject: DeployBot v2 ready for review

Hey folks,

The new DeployBot is finally answering status queries in under a second — no more typing /where-is-my-deploy into the void. Marguerite rewrote the polling layer so it subscribes to pipeline events instead of hammering the Fennwick API every ten seconds. Reviewers: please poke at the fallback path where the event stream drops, since that's where v1 kept lying to us. Staging has the candidate live now. The build it's running is listed below.

session token of yajof-bagef = htk4_937d